Kinds Of Window Mechanisms

Before diving into repair specifics, it's important to comprehend the numerous types of window systems. Each type has special attributes and might require different repair techniques:

Type of WindowSystem Characteristics
Moving WindowsRun on a track system, allowing horizontal movement.
Double-Hung WindowsFeature two sashes that go up and down. Typically equipped with balance systems like springs or cables.
Casement WindowsHinged at the side, opening outside utilizing a crank mechanism.
Awning WindowsHinged at the top, opening outside from the bottom.
Bay or Bow WindowsMade up of several window units creating a protruding structure.

Comprehending the kind of window system involved is the very first action towards fixing and repair.

Typical Window Mechanism Issues

1. Stuck Windows

One of the most common issues is a window that will not open or close correctly.  window lock repair in bedford  may arise from dirt, particles, or obstructions in the tracks, or due to mechanical failure.

2. Broken Cords or Springs

Double-hung windows count on cords and springs to operate efficiently. If these components break or use out, the window can end up being tough to operate.

3. Crank Failure

For casement and awning windows, the crank mechanism can use down or break. This avoids the window from opening or closing effectively.

4. Deformed Frames

Extreme weather can warp window frames, making it difficult to seal correctly. This can lead to drafts and water ingress.

5. Harmed Seals

Window seals protect against air and water leakages. When these seals become damaged, they can compromise insulation and lead to condensation.

Repair Process

Action 1: Assess the Damage

Before beginning any repair, examine the degree of the damage. Think about the following:

  • Are the tracks tidy and clear?
  • Do the cords or springs show signs of wear?
  • Is the crank system working effectively?
  • Are the window frames distorted or harmed?
  • Are the seals undamaged?

Action 2: Gather Required Tools and Materials

The tools you'll need can vary based on the specific repairs needed. However, some common items may include:

  • Screwdrivers (flathead and Phillips)
  • Pliers
  • Replacement cables or springs
  • Lubricant
  • Caulk for sealing
  • Cleaning up materials (brushes, fabrics)

Step 3: Repair or Replace Mechanisms

Based on your preliminary evaluation, continue with the following repair work:

Cleaning Track Systems

  • Remove dirt and debris utilizing a brush or vacuum.
  • Apply lube to ensure smooth motion.

Replacing Cords or Springs

  • Thoroughly eliminate the window sash.
  • Replace old cords/springs with new ones.
  • Reattach the sash and test performance.

Repairing Crank Mechanisms

  • Unscrew the crank deal with and examine for damage.
  • Replace the crank if broken.
  • Reattach and test the window.

Addressing Warped Frames

  • Look for structural damage.
  • Change or replace hinges if necessary.
  • Consider weather stripping for draft issues.

Sealing Damaged Areas

  • Remove old sealant.
  • Clean the area before using new caulk.
  • Allow adequate drying time for the sealant.

Step 4: Test the Window

After finishing repair work, test the window multiple times to guarantee smooth operation. This will help validate that the issue has actually been successfully attended to.

Maintenance Tips for Longevity

Preventive upkeep goes a long way in extending the life of window systems. Here are some practical pointers:

Regular Cleaning

  • Clean window tracks and hardware a minimum of as soon as a season to prevent buildup.

Regular Inspections

  • Inspect cords, springs, and cranks frequently for indications of wear.

Lubrication

  • Use a lube on moving parts to prevent friction and wear.

Seal Checks

  • Inspect seals for stability and reapply caulk as required.

Weatherstripping

  • Install weatherstripping if drafts are spotted to preserve energy performance.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: How do I know if I require to repair or replace my window mechanism?

A: If the window is challenging to run in spite of cleaning and lubricating, it may be time for a replacement mechanism. Nevertheless, if small issues are present, repair work are often enough.

Q2: Can I carry out these repair work myself?

A: Many repair work can be done by homeowners armed with fundamental tools and abilities. Nevertheless, for complicated concerns or if you're unsure, consulting a professional is recommended.

Q3: What are the costs associated with window system repair?

A: Repair expenses differ based on the type of mechanism and level of damage. Small repairs can cost as little as ₤ 50, while more comprehensive repairs may exceed ₤ 200.

Q4: How frequently should I perform maintenance on my windows?

A: It is suggested to carry out maintenance a minimum of two times a year, preferably throughout seasonal changes, to catch any possible issues early.

Q5: What should I look for when purchasing replacement parts?

A: Ensure that the replacement parts work with your window type. It might be practical to consult your window maker for particular parts.
